Khajuria is a Rural village located in Sonhaula, Bhagalpur, Bihar.

The total population of Khajuria is 1,439.

Khajuria village comprises 251 households.

The literacy rate in Khajuria is 66.9%. Among the literate population of 784, there are 512 literate males and 272 literate females.

In Khajuria, there are 792 males and 647 females, with a sex ratio of 817 females per 1000 males.

There are 267 children (18.6% of population), comprising 140 boys and 127 girls.

The total number of workers in Khajuria is 686, with 302 main workers and 384 marginal workers.

In Khajuria, there are 277 people belonging to Scheduled Castes (151 males, 126 females) and 0 people belonging to Scheduled Tribes (0 males, 0 females).

Khajuria is located in Bihar state, Bhagalpur district, and falls under Sonhaula Tehsil. The village's Census 2011 code is 240353 and LGD code is 240353.
